As an Operations Assistant based in Reading you will be responsible for:
- Loading and unloading vehicles
- Working within the warehouse picking/packing goods/stock checking
- Relief driver when required, delivery driving 3.5T van
This is a permanent, full-time position working 40 hours per week, Monday to Friday 7:00am - 16:00pm, with occasional Saturday work on a rota 8:00am - 12:00pm.
Full UK Driving license required.
